Game math realities RTP volatility and payout patterns on revolut betting sites not on gamstop

Understanding game math is essential when using revolut betting sites not on gamstop. RTP, short for return to player, represents the long term average return of a game and is independent of any single session outcome. On online slots, table games, and live dealer titles, RTP values vary from game to game and across categories. Volatility or variance describes how often big wins occur versus the size of those wins; high volatility games tend to pay less frequently but offer larger payouts on occasional hits, while low volatility games pay more often with smaller wins. Hit frequency is a practical way to describe how often a mechanic pays out over non gamstop casino a run of spins or bets. In practice, a given revolut betting site not on gamstop may offer titles with a wide range of RTP and volatility profiles. Players should separate the long run RTP from their short term results, and avoid expecting constant wins. A clear understanding of these factors helps players set realistic expectations about how a session might progress.

Bankroll planning and realistic betting limits on revolut betting sites not on gamstop

Bankroll management is a cornerstone of responsible gambling, especially on platforms not bound by GamStop rules. Start by calculating an overall entertainment budget and dividing it into a staking plan that aligns with the game choice and risk tolerance. A conservative approach might allocate a fixed percentage of the bankroll per session, with an upper cap on the maximum bet to prevent rapid drawdown during negative sequences. For example, if a player has a bankroll of 200 units for a night, they might limit individual bets to 2–5 units and set a time-based stopping rule. It is also important to account for withdrawal limits and rolling funds between games with different volatility. Many revolut betting sites not on gamstop enforce maximum bet rules for certain promotions or game features; tracking these limits helps prevent overexposure. In addition, players should be mindful of the impact of compounding losses and avoid chasing damage after a losing streak.

Bonus mechanics wagering requirements game weighting maximum bets and expiry on revolut betting sites not on gamstop

Bonuses at revolut betting sites not on gamstop can be attractive but complex. Common mechanics include a match bonus on first deposits, free spins, or risk-free bets, each with wagering requirements that specify how many times the bonus plus bonus winnings must be staked before withdrawal. Game weighting assigns different contribution rates toward wagering requirements; slots often count fully, while table games may contribute only a fraction or nothing at all. Maximum-bet rules limit how much can be staked per bet while a bonus is active, which can affect strategy. Expiry dates apply to wagering requirements and bonus eligibility, meaning players must complete the conditions within a set period. Withdrawal restrictions may apply to bonus funds, and some offers require using specific payment methods. Players should read the terms carefully, noting the effective wagering multiple, eligible games, and any caps on winnings from bonus bets. Responsible gambling means acknowledging that bonuses are not guaranteed paths to profits and can reduce real money value if misused.
